Ada Lovelace Day

by Elsa 24 March 2009 16:03

It is here, Ada Lovelace Day.

Created by Suw Charman-Anderson, to help promote women in technology, it is a day dedicated to blogging about women who are admired and successful within technology. Brilliant idea Suw and I'm delighted to see that it has really taken off and seen some great support.

Girl Geek Dinners are about bringing together women that are passionate about technology to share conversation and ideas in a friendly atmosphere.
